Bacteriophages are virusses that each 'hit on' a specific bacteria.

How is that relevant?

Well, they were discovered around the same time that antibiotics were created, about a hundred years ago.
They both 'do' roughly the same thing: they attack bacteria-life.

However, because antibiotics could be patended (being a human invention) and bacteriophages could not (being easy to find parts of living nature), the Westrern World chose to 'go with' the development and use (on a large scale) of anitbiotics, instead of bacteriophages.

Also, anitbiotiocs seemed more 'practical', for you can kills many diffrent bacterial birds with one stone, while bacteriophages are very bactery type specific.
So, a doctor/medical laboratory has to identify the right bacteria first and then add the right bacteriophage to conquer it.

A hundred years of health-'care' history have brought us now to the point where our antibiotics usage policy, proves to have some counterproductive side-effects.
The world of bacteria has adapted itself to this and many are antibiotics-resistent.
Meaning.... more and more people can't get rid of 'simple' bacterial infections.... keep suffering and an increasing (and large) number of them even die.

Also, it turns out that killing rather blindly all bacteria in a system, (sometimes even done preventively!) is not neccesarily a good idea for your wellbeing, because the 1,5 kilo of 'good' bactaria in your gut, turns out to play a significant role in the proper functioning of one's immune systems.

For. luckily, the knowlegde on bacteriophages has been guarded and extenened over the past decades in Georgia, a former part of Russia.
Over there, due to the historic context they were living in, they simply couldn't affort antibiotics and thus, they made an effort to cultivated a wide collection of bacterophages.
In Georgia, that is common everyday treatment of bacterial infections.
